package report.builder;

import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.Map;

import org.json.simple.JSONArray;
import org.json.simple.JSONObject;

import fr.opensagres.xdocreport.template.IContext;
import fr.opensagres.xdocreport.template.formatter.FieldsMetadata;

/**
 * @author Benjamin Bouguet
 *
 */
public class ListBuilder implements IContextBuilder {

    /**
     * Initializes the FieldsMetaData with the key of the JSON data
     * and adds the list to the report's context.
     * @param listObject The JSON list object.
     */
    @Override
    public void build(JSONObject json, FieldsMetadata metadata, IContext context) {
        // Iterates on all the list:
        Iterator<?> iter = json.entrySet().iterator();
        while (iter.hasNext()) {
            // Gets the key and the array:
            Map.Entry<?, ?> entry = (Map.Entry<?, ?>) iter.next();
            String key = entry.getKey().toString();
            JSONArray array = (JSONArray) entry.getValue();

            // Gets the FieldsMetaData, searching for all different keys on the Map:
            HashSet<String> metaData = new HashSet<String>();
            Iterator<?> iterArray = array.iterator();
            while (iterArray.hasNext()) {
                JSONObject map = (JSONObject) iterArray.next();
                Iterator<?> iterMap = map.entrySet().iterator();
                while (iterMap.hasNext()) {
                    Map.Entry<?, ?> entryMap = (Map.Entry<?, ?>) iterMap.next();
                    metaData.add(entryMap.getKey().toString());
                }
            }

            // Sets the FieldsMetaData:
            Iterator<?> iterMetaData = metaData.iterator();
            while (iterMetaData.hasNext()) {
                metadata.addFieldAsList(key + "." + iterMetaData.next().toString());
            }

            // Adds the array to the report's context.
            // array can be directly passed as a value for contextMap because it inherits from ArrayList.
            context.put(key, array);
        }
    }

}
